GroupDocs.Parser Java Kullanarak Belgeyi HTML’ye Dönüştürme: Adım Adım Kılavuz

Bir dosyadan metin çıkarmak ve belgeyi HTML’ye dönüştürmek zorlayıcı olabilir, özellikle biçimlendirmeyi korumanız gerektiğinde. Bu öğreticide, GroupDocs.Parser for Java’ı kullanarak belgeyi HTML’ye dönüştür, docx’i HTML’e parse et ve belgeyi HTML olarak temiz, sürdürülebilir bir şekilde okuma adımlarını ayrıntılı olarak göstereceğiz. Sonunda, Word dosyalarını web‑dostu HTML içeriğine dönüştüren hazır bir kod parçacığına sahip olacaksınız.

Hızlı Yanıtlar

  • HTML dönüşümünü hangi kütüphane yönetir? GroupDocs.Parser for Java
  • Hangi mod HTML çıkarır? FormattedTextMode.Html
  • Lisans almam gerekiyor mu? Test için ücretsiz deneme veya geçici lisans yeterlidir; üretim için tam lisans gereklidir.
  • DOCX dosyalarını parse edebilir miyim? Evet – parser DOCX, PDF, PPTX ve daha birçok formatı destekler.
  • Bellek yönetimi önemli mi? Kesinlikle; sızıntıları önlemek için parser ve okuyucuları her zaman kapatın.

Giriş

Java kullanarak belgelerden metin çıkarmak ve bunu HTML formatına dönüştürmek zorlayıcı olabilir. Birçok geliştirici, belirli formatlar (örneğin HTML) için belge parse ederken zorluklarla karşılaşır. Bu kılavuz, GroupDocs.Parser Java ile belge metnini HTML olarak çıkarmanın sürecini adım adım gösterir – çeşitli belge formatlarını işleyebilen sağlam bir kütüphane.

Bu öğreticiyi izleyerek, belge içeriğini sorunsuz bir şekilde HTML’ye dönüştürmeyi, web platformlarında görüntülemeyi ve manipüle etmeyi öğreneceksiniz. Şimdi neler öğreneceğinize bir göz atalım:

  • Java projenize GroupDocs.Parser’ı ekleme
  • HTML modunu kullanarak belgelerden biçimlendirilmiş metin çıkarma
  • Çıkarılan HTML içeriğinin pratik uygulamaları

Bu amaçla GroupDocs.Parser’ı nasıl etkili bir şekilde kullanabileceğinizi keşfedelim.

Önkoşullar

Başlamadan önce aşağıdaki önkoşulları karşıladığınızdan emin olun:

Gerekli Kütüphaneler, Sürümler ve Bağımlılıklar

GroupDocs.Parser kütüphanesini Maven ile entegre edin veya GroupDocs web sitesinden indirin. Uyumluluk için 25.5 sürümünü kullanın.

Ortam Kurulum Gereksinimleri

  • Java Development Kit (JDK): Sisteminizde JDK yüklü olmalı.
  • IDE: IntelliJ IDEA, Eclipse veya NetBeans gibi bir IDE kullanabilirsiniz.
  • Build Tool: Bağımlılık yönetimi için Maven veya Gradle kurun.

Bilgi Önkoşulları

Java programlamaya aşina olmak ve belge işleme kütüphaneleri hakkında temel bilgi sahibi olmak faydalı olacaktır. HTML temellerini bilmek yararlı, zorunlu değil.

GroupDocs.Parser for Java Kurulumu

Java projenizde GroupDocs.Parser’ı kullanmaya başlamak için şu adımları izleyin:

Maven Kurulumu

pom.xml dosyanı aşağıdaki repository ve bağımlılığı ekleyin:

<repositories>
   <repository>
      <id>repository.groupdocs.com</id>
      <name>GroupDocs Repository</name>
      <url>https://releases.groupdocs.com/parser/java/</url>
   </repository>
</repositories>

<dependencies>
   <dependency>
      <groupId>com.groupdocs</groupId>
      <artifactId>groupdocs-parser</artifactId>
      <version>25.5</version>
   </dependency>
</dependencies>

Doğrudan İndirme

Maven kullanmak istemiyorsanız, en son sürümü GroupDocs.Parser for Java releases adresinden indirin.

Lisans Edinme

  • Ücretsiz Deneme: GroupDocs.Parser’ı test etmek için ücretsiz deneme ile başlayın.
  • Geçici Lisans: Tüm özelliklere uzun süreli erişim için geçici bir lisans alın.
  • Satın Alma: Uzun vadeli kullanım için tam lisans satın almayı düşünün.

Kütüphaneyi kurduktan sonra projenizde aşağıdaki gibi başlatın:

import com.groupdocs.parser.Parser;

public class DocumentParser {
    public static void main(String[] args) {
        String docum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.docx";
        try (Parser parser = new Parser(documentPath)) {
            // Your code will go here
        } catch (Exception e) {
            System.out.println("Error initializing GroupDocs.Parser: " + e.getMessage());
        }
    }
}

Uygulama Kılavuzu

Ortamınız hazır olduğuna göre, belgeyi HTML’ye dönüştür ve biçimlendirilmiş metni çıkarma özelliğini uygulayalım.

HTML Modu Kullanarak Biçimlendirilmiş Metni Çıkarma

Bu özellik, belge içeriğini yapılandırılmış bir HTML formatında almanızı sağlar. Aşağıdaki adımları izleyin:

Adım 1: Gerekli Paketleri İçe Aktarın

Java dosyanızın başında tüm gerekli paketlerin içe aktarıldığından emin olun:

import com.groupdocs.parser.Parser;
import com.groupdocs.parser.data.TextReader;
import com.groupdocs.parser.options.FormattedTextOptions;
import com.groupdocs.parser.options.FormattedTextMode;

Adım 2: Parser’ı Başlat ve HTML Çıkar

Aşağıdaki kod parçacığını kullanarak HTML olarak biçimlendirilmiş metni çıkarın:

String docum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.docx";

try (Parser parser = new Parser(documentPath)) {
    // Extract formatted text using HTML mode
    try (TextReader reader = parser.getFormattedText(new FormattedTextOptions(FormattedTextMode.Html))) {
        if (reader != null) {
            String htmlContent = reader.readToEnd();
            System.out.println("Extracted HTML Content: \n" + htmlContent);
        } else {
            System.out.println("Formatted text extraction isn't supported for this document.");
        }
    }
} catch (Exception e) {
    System.out.println("An error occurred: " + e.getMessage());
}

Açıklama:

  • Parser Başlatma: Hedef dosya için bir Parser örneği oluşturur.
  • FormattedTextOptions: Parser’a HTML (FormattedTextMode.Html) çıktısı vermesini söyler.
  • Hata Yönetimi: Oluşabilecek sorunları yakalar ve nazikçe raporlar.

Sorun Giderme İpuçları

  • Belge yolunun doğru ve dosyanın okunabilir olduğundan emin olun.
  • Kullanmakta olduğunuz GroupDocs.Parser sürümünün ilgili format için HTML çıkarımını desteklediğini doğrulayın.
  • ClassNotFoundException hataları alıyorsanız Maven/Gradle bağımlılıklarını tekrar kontrol edin.

Pratik Uygulamalar

Belge içinden HTML çıkarmak birçok olasılık sunar:

  1. Web İçeriği Oluşturma: Raporları veya kılavuzları anında çevrimiçi erişim için web sayfalarına dönüştürün.
  2. Veri Entegrasyonu: HTML’i bir CMS veya headless API’ye besleyerek dinamik sayfalar üretin.
  3. İçerik Analizi: Yapısal ipuçlarını koruyarak HTML’i metin‑analiz boru hatları veya makine‑öğrenme modelleriyle çalıştırın.

Performans Düşünceleri

GroupDocs.Parser’ı en iyi performansla kullanmak için:

  • Kaynakları Hemen Kapatın: Belleği serbest bırakmak için her zaman try‑with‑resources (gösterildiği gibi) kullanın.
  • Büyük Dosyaları Akışla İşleyin: Bellek sınırına ulaşırsanız büyük belgeleri parçalar halinde işleyin.
  • Parser Örneklerini Yeniden Kullanın: Aynı tipte birden çok dosya parse ederken tek bir Parser yapılandırmasını tekrar kullanın.

Sonuç

GroupDocs.Parser for Java kullanarak belgeyi HTML’ye dönüştürmeyi öğrendiniz. Bu yetenek, belge içeriğini web üzerinde sunma, entegre etme ve analiz etme konusunda güçlü yollar açar.

Sonraki Adımlar:

  • PDF veya düz metin gibi diğer çıktı formatlarıyla da deneyler yapın.
  • HTML çıkarımını bir şablon motoru ile birleştirerek tam özellikli web sayfaları oluşturun.
  • Tablolar, görseller ve meta verileri çıkarmak için tam API’yi keşfedin.

Sık Sorulan Sorular

S: GroupDocs.Parser Java ne için kullanılır?
C: Geniş bir belge formatı yelpazesinden metin, meta veri ve biçimlendirilmiş içerik (HTML dahil) çıkarmak için çok yönlü bir kütüphanedir.

S: Bu kütüphane ile docx’i html’e parse edebilir miyim?
C: Evet—FormattedTextMode.Html‘i ayarladığınızda parser DOCX içeriğini HTML olarak döndürür.

S: Büyük belgeleri parse ederken performans etkisi olur mu?
C: Büyük dosyalar daha fazla bellek tüketir, ancak try‑with‑resources ve akış teknikleri bu etkiyi azaltır.

S: Desteklenmeyen belge özellikleriyle nasıl başa çıkılır?
C: Parser, desteklenmeyen çıkarım modları için null döndürür; bu durumda geri dönüş mantığı uygulayın veya kullanıcıyı bilgilendirin.

S: GroupDocs.Parser Java hakkında daha fazla kaynak nerede bulunur?
C: Daha fazla ipucu ve örnek için resmi dokümantasyon sayfasını ziyaret edin ve topluluk forumlarını inceleyin.

Kaynaklar


Son Güncelleme: 2026-01-01
Test Edilen Versiyon: GroupDocs.Parser 25.5 for Java
Yazar: GroupDocs